Basic facts about this digital color

The digital color #3F73EE is classified in the Register under the Azure Color Family, with High Saturation and Light brightness. Its exact recipe is rgb(63, 115, 238) — 24.7% red, 45.1% green, 93.3% blue — and for print it converts to CMYK 69 / 48 / 0 / 7.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

A energetic, saturated azure, #3F73EE sits on the lighter side of the spectrum. Designers typically reach for tones like this for logos, highlights and anything that needs to be noticed first.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a near neighbor of Bluetiful (#3C69E7). Nearby in the Register you will also find Ultramarine Blue (#4166F5) and Lightish Blue (#3D7AFD).

In RGB terms — rgb(63, 115, 238) — the blue channel does the heavy lifting here. On this background, black text reaches a 4.9:1 contrast ratio (passing WCAG AA); white stays at 4.3:1. No one has named #3F73EE so far. Register a name for it and it becomes a permanent record.

#3F73EE color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
